Torgny Almgren is a leading researcher in industrial human-robot collaboration (HRC), with a focus on transforming manual labor manufacturing through intelligent automation. His most-cited work, "A Framework for Realizing Industrial Human-Robot Collaboration through Virtual Simulation" (2020, 20 citations), addresses the critical challenge of integrating collaborative robots into real-world production environments. Almgren’s key contribution lies in developing a simulation-based framework that enables manufacturers to design and test HRC systems virtually, mitigating the risks and costs of physical implementation. By identifying that the greatest barrier to large-scale HRC adoption is the lack of robust planning tools, his research provides a practical pathway for deploying robots that relieve workers from heavy, repetitive tasks and manual quality inspections.
